Minotaur Figure Picture

This is a Minotaur figure made by Safari and I bought it on eBay. Decided to get him since I was collecting God Of War figures so I thought might as well also collect mythology figures as well

Minotaur belongs to the Greco-Roman world
Continue Reading: Figures